Outside this sacred sexuality realm, the stereotypes of sexually active women with multiple partners still exist. What is a ho’? The definition should be simple, but with the evolution of women embracing their sexuality and shamelessly expressing it, the word has become quite complex.
Recently, the good folks over at Merriam Webster added the word ho’ to the dictionary. It’s claimed to be a synonym to the word “whore,” which gives the following definition.
1 : a woman who engages in sexual acts for money : prostitute; also : a promiscuous or immoral woman 2 : a male who engages in sexual acts for money 3 : a venal or unscrupulous person
Interesting…
I know many women who could fit that definition or could at one point in their lives. Yet, I would never describe them as a whore or a ho’ for simply loving themselves and placing their needs before another person’s standards. Every woman has sexual needs. Some can be fulfilled through monogamous sex; others need more than one partner. Does that make the latter promiscuous? A whore? A ho’? I pray that I’m preaching to the choir, but when will people just accept that there is no blueprint for how one should conduct themselves sexually. Just as humans have the ability to engage in sexual intercourse (or other sexual acts *smirk*), they should have the liberty to create their own standards on what is acceptable. Once you create your personal boundaries, keep them to yourself. Let other people live as they choose.
